easyVDR Kopie des easyVDR-Forums zum Nachschlagen
easyVDR0.5RC mit Digitainer 2 an 15" TFT

easyVDR - >VARforumsname - >easyVDR0.5RC mit Digitainer 2 an 15" TFT

joda999  05.Nov.2007 15:23:06
Hallo,

ich habe mir einen DigitainerII  zum "spielen" zugelegt und soweit läuft er erstmal, jedoch bekomme ich die Auflösung am VGA-Ausgang nicht ordentlich eingestellt.
fbset -i

mode "720x576-50"
    # D: 28.000 MHz, H: 31.250 kHz, V: 50.000 Hz
    geometry 720 576 720 1152 32
    timings 35714 32 8 46 0 136 3
    bcast true
    rgba 8/16,8/8,8/0,8/24
endmode

Frame buffer device information:
    Name        : UNICHROME
    Address    : 0xe0000000
    Size        : 16510976
    Type        : PACKED PIXELS
    Visual      : TRUECOLOR
    XPanStep    : 0
    YPanStep    : 1
    YWrapStep  : 0
    LineLength  : 2880
    MMIO Address: 0xe6000000
    MMIO Size  : 16777216
    Accelerator : Unknown (77)


Ich habe alle Möglichkeiten der fb.modules ausprobiert und leider zeigt mein 15" TFT nur mit oben genannter Einstellung ein Bild, das natürlich total verzerrt ist. Wer kann mir erklären was ich machen muss damit ich am VGA-Ausgang eine Auflösung von 1024x768 mit 60 HZ bekomme???

Max. Auflösung  1024*768@75 Hz
Empfohlene Auflösung  1024*768@60 Hz
Horizontalfrequenz  31-60 KHz
Vertikalfrequenz  56-75 Hz

Dank vorab

Joda999
VDR1: SW EasyVDR 07.14 / HW: Asus M3N78-VM, AMD Sempron 140, 2048 MB RAM, 2x Skystar HD2, SAMSUNG HD753LJ, L4M
VDR2: SW: zen2vdr / HW: Samsung SMT-7020S
wbreu  05.Nov.2007 19:05:21
Hallo Joda999,

na das kann ja so nicht klappen.

Um dem viafb ne andere Auflösung mitzugeben ist es notwendig (bei Version 0.5RC1) in der RCStart den viafb-Aufruf abzuändern.

Zudem muss die directfbrc von 720x576 auf 1024x768 abgeändert werden.
Auch muss der 1024x768-Mode in der fb.modes mit 60Hz enthalten sein, sonst gibts nen schwarzen Schirm! :o

Änderungen am softdevice-Aufruf in der sysconfig und der vdr-setup.xml: das :viatv muss weg

Beides habe ich hier:

http://www.easy-vdr.de/forum/index.php?topic=676.msg5087#msg5087

und hier:

http://www.easy-vdr.de/forum/index.php?topic=3050.0

beschrieben.

Gruß
Wolfgang
joda999  06.Nov.2007 18:34:09
Hallo wbreu,

ich habe verzweifelt versucht das hinzubekommen, aber ohne weitere Hilfe komme ich nicht weiter.

Hier sind die geänderten Einstellungen:
sysconfig:
PLUGINLIST=" \"-Psoftdevice -ao alsa:pcm=default -vo dfb:triple:cle266\"  \"-Psoftplay --media-path /media\"  \"-Pa
RCStart:
modprobe viafb mode=1024x768 bpp=32 TVon=1 TVtype=2 TVoverscan=1 refresh=60
directfbrc:
fbdev=/dev/fb0
quiet
log-file=/var/log/directfb
#mode=720x576
mode=1024x768
#mode=1280x1024
#mode=1280x768
#mode=1366x768
...
fb.modes
fbset

mode "1024x768-60"
    # D: 64.998 MHz, H: 48.362 kHz, V: 60.002 Hz
    geometry 1024 768 1024 1536 32
    timings 15385 160 24 29 3 136 6
    rgba 8/16,8/8,8/0,8/24
endmode

vdr-setup.xml:



Leider bekomme ich kein Bild auf den Monitor und er schreibt nur VGA MODE NOT SUPPORT.
Habe ich etwas vergessen, oder woran kann es noch liegen ???
Ich verlinke die Frage noch im VDR Portal, damit es nicht wieder mecker gibt ::) .

Danke schonmal für deine Mühe.

Gruß Joda999


VDR1: SW EasyVDR 07.14 / HW: Asus M3N78-VM, AMD Sempron 140, 2048 MB RAM, 2x Skystar HD2, SAMSUNG HD753LJ, L4M
VDR2: SW: zen2vdr / HW: Samsung SMT-7020S
tr500  06.Nov.2007 18:40:17
Hi Joda
Setz doch mal bei dem Modul aufruf das hier "TVon=1" auf "TVon=0" könnte sein das bei aktiviertem TV-Out Ausgang nix anderes als PAL(720x576) möglich ist.
Gruß Tom

Ich nutze kein EASYVDR geb aber trotzdem meinen Senf ab ;)
wbreu  06.Nov.2007 18:43:19
[quote='tr500 link' pid='3038' dateline='1194370817']
Hi Joda
Setz doch mal bei dem Modul aufruf das hier "TVon=1" auf "TVon=0" könnte sein das bei aktiviertem TV-Out Ausgang nix anderes als PAL(720x576) möglich ist.


Hallo tr500,

jepp so ist es, und es darf auch am Scart je nach Bios-Einstellung kein anderes Gerät hängen.

TVon=1 TVtype=2 TVoverscan=1 => Diese Parameter haben im VGA-Betrieb beim viafb-Aufruf nichts zu suchen.

Zudem wäre die Ausgabe von fbset -i auf der Konsole interessant!

Gruß
Wolfgang
joda999  06.Nov.2007 18:52:30
Hallo,

das

TVon=1 TVtype=2 TVoverscan=1 => Diese Parameter haben im VGA-Betrieb beim viafb-Aufruf nichts zu suchen.

war der entscheidene Hinweis !!!!!


und hier noch fbset -i

fbset -i

mode "1024x768-60"
    # D: 64.998 MHz, H: 48.362 kHz, V: 60.002 Hz
    geometry 1024 768 1024 1536 32
    timings 15385 160 24 29 3 136 6
    rgba 8/16,8/8,8/0,8/24
endmode

Frame buffer device information:
    Name        : UNICHROME
    Address    : 0xe4000000
    Size        : 33288192
    Type        : PACKED PIXELS
    Visual      : TRUECOLOR
    XPanStep    : 0
    YPanStep    : 1
    YWrapStep  : 0
    LineLength  : 4096
    MMIO Address: 0xe8000000
    MMIO Size  : 16777216
    Accelerator : Unknown (77)



Vielen vielen Dank

Gruß Joda999
VDR1: SW EasyVDR 07.14 / HW: Asus M3N78-VM, AMD Sempron 140, 2048 MB RAM, 2x Skystar HD2, SAMSUNG HD753LJ, L4M
VDR2: SW: zen2vdr / HW: Samsung SMT-7020S
tr500  06.Nov.2007 19:19:20
Hi Wolfang

und es darf auch am Scart je nach Bios-Einstellung kein anderes Gerät hängen

Woher weiss der Digi denn das da was dran hängt ?
AFAIK Sind da nur 4 "Bild"Pins belegt RGB und einen für die RGB Umschaltung zum TV hin.
Gruß Tom

Ich nutze kein EASYVDR geb aber trotzdem meinen Senf ab ;)
wbreu  06.Nov.2007 19:28:07
Hallo Tom,

naja ich habe das letztens bei meinen xineliboutput-Versuchen festgestellt, dass es besser ist wenn kein anderes Gerät mehr am Digi hängt.

Ab un zu kam da bei gestecktem Scart und angeschlossenem VGA gar kein Bild auf dem LCD, nicht mal auf der Konsole. Ich vermute mal dass der Digi da versucht irgendwas zu syncen.

Zudem werden über den VGA-Anschluß über X auch die Parameter des Monitors ausgelesen (sieht man im Logfile des X-Servers).

Also muss da irgendwo ne Datenabfrage laufen. Hie rmal der Auszug aus dem Log:

(II) Loading sub module "ddc"
(II) LoadModule: "ddc"
(II) Reloading /usr/lib/xorg/modules/libddc.so
(II) VIA(0): I2C device "I2C bus 1:ddc2" registered at address 0xA0.
(II) VIA(0): I2C device "I2C bus 1:ddc2" removed.
(II) VIA(0): Manufacturer: SAM  Model: 1d3  Serial#: 1146040633
(II) VIA(0): Year: 2006  Week: 29
(II) VIA(0): EDID Version: 1.3
(II) VIA(0): Analog Display Input,  Input Voltage Level: 0.700/0.700 V
(II) VIA(0): Sync:  Separate  Composite
(II) VIA(0): Max H-Image Size : horiz.: 41  vert.: 26
(II) VIA(0): Gamma: 2.20
(II) VIA(0): DPMS capabilities: Off; RGB/Color Display
(II) VIA(0): First detailed timing is preferred mode
(II) VIA(0): redX: 0.640 redY: 0.329  greenX: 0.300 greenY: 0.600
(II) VIA(0): blueX: 0.150 blueY: 0.060  whiteX: 0.313 whiteY: 0.329
(II) VIA(0): Supported VESA Video Modes:
(II) VIA(0): 720x400@70Hz
(II) VIA(0): 640x480@60Hz
(II) VIA(0): 640x480@67Hz
(II) VIA(0): 640x480@72Hz
(II) VIA(0): 640x480@75Hz
(II) VIA(0): 800x600@56Hz
(II) VIA(0): 800x600@60Hz
(II) VIA(0): 800x600@72Hz
(II) VIA(0): 800x600@75Hz
(II) VIA(0): 832x624@75Hz
(II) VIA(0): 1024x768@60Hz
(II) VIA(0): 1024x768@70Hz
(II) VIA(0): 1024x768@75Hz
(II) VIA(0): 1280x1024@75Hz
(II) VIA(0): 1152x870@75Hz
(II) VIA(0): Manufacturer's mask: 0
(II) VIA(0): Supported Future Video Modes:
(II) VIA(0): #0: hsize: 1440  vsize 900  refresh: 60  vid: 149
(II) VIA(0): #1: hsize: 1440  vsize 900  refresh: 75  vid: 3989
(II) VIA(0): #2: hsize: 1280  vsize 1024  refresh: 60  vid: 32897
(II) VIA(0): #3: hsize: 1280  vsize 960  refresh: 60  vid: 16513
(II) VIA(0): #4: hsize: 1152  vsize 864  refresh: 75  vid: 20337
(II) VIA(0): Supported additional Video Mode:
(II) VIA(0): clock: 106.5 MHz  Image Size:  408 x 225 mm
(II) VIA(0): h_active: 1440  h_sync: 1520  h_sync_end 1672 h_blank_end 1904 h_border: 0
(II) VIA(0): v_active: 900  v_sync: 903  v_sync_end 909 v_blanking: 934 v_border: 0
(II) VIA(0): Ranges: V min: 56  V max: 75 Hz, H min: 30  H max: 81 kHz, PixClock max 140 MHz
(II) VIA(0): Monitor name: SyncMaster
(II) VIA(0): Serial No: HSXL700235
(II) VIA(0): I2C device "I2C bus 2:VT162x" registered at address 0x40.


Gruß
Wolfgang